Leesville Road 13, Middle Creek 3

Bookmark and Share

By Dave Malenick
Correspondent
APEX — Leesville Road used a strong defensive effort to defeat Middle Creek 13-3 on Friday night and remain unbeaten.
The Pride improved to 5-0 despite committing three turnovers. The Mustangs (1-3) also turned the ball over twice.
“We had way too many turnovers tonight,” said Leesville coach David Greene, whose Pride begin Cap Seven 4-A conference play next week. “Our kids did play hard and physical all night, and our defense really executed the game plan.”
Zach Gentry led the Pride with 96 yards rushing.
Middle Creek opened the scoring with a 22-yard field goal by Matt Frongello midway through the opening quarter.
Leesville Road used a 14-play, 72-yard drive early in the second quarter to go ahead 7-3.
Gentry and Dylan Edwards accounted for most of the yardage on the drive, but Pride quarterback Jake Groeschen tossed a 3-yard touchdown pass to Thurston Cox-Keyes.
The Mustangs had their opportunities to go back ahead throughout the remainder of the game, but the stingy Pride defense kept the talented Middle Creek wide receivers from breaking any big gains in the passing game.
“We knew they were going to throw a lot with those bookend receivers,” Greene said about Marvin Mackey and Tre Nesbit.
Mackey did gain 96 receiving yards, but Leesville Road safety Ryan Mangum intercepted two passes to squash Mustangs scoring chances.
The Pride ended the game with a 62-yard drive, all on the ground. Edwards scored on a tough 9-yard run where he broke three tackles en route to the end zone.
“These guys had to play under adversity, and this will help them down the road,” Greene said. “Every game will be a dogfight.”
